Dr. Louis Benezet '38, President of Colorado College in Colorado Springs, was our guest at luncheon on Friday, February 26.

The vicissitudes of a college president are many, none the least significant of which is the changing attitudes in students of college age. Gone apparently is some of the rah rah spirit and sense of identification with the school with replacement by wariness and calculated moderation of personality projection.

On a Thursday night two or three weeks ago, the Club had a jim-dandy smoker with movies at the University Club. Nobody at this writing has said he didn't have a good time. "Football Highlights" were shown and it was good to see the Big Green in action. Don McMichael '53 and his enrollment committee planned for this one, and Don reports a record number of applications to the class of '64 from our area with interviews in full swing.

We were glad to welcome Captain Robert Drawbaugh '54, newly come from Hickam Field and now at Lowry Field, teaching navigational instruction to the Air Force Cadets.
